Re: New Member, M635csi
I got similar wheel spec but have 255/40/17 on rear. U need to employ some counter measures to cope with the stagger otherwise understeer is a big issue. Front and rear strut tower bars are defiantly worth it, and a rear adjutable sway bar. Upgrading all bushes really helps these cars also. Along w...
